Away From The Crowd But Close To The Fun

A luxury vacation with your wolfpack is easy when you stay at King Wolf Lodge! Nestled in the Smoky Mountains there sits this semi-secluded cabin, less than half a mile from the Spur on easy to drive roads. When you arrive, drop your groceries in the modern kitchen & head straight for the game room upstairs. Fix a few beverages at the wet bar & get ready for hours of fun - from pool to shuffleboard to arcade games! Wind down afterward by stepping into the adjacent theater room. Press play on your favorites and have a movie marathon. Out on the screened porch, grill up a supper for the most beastly of appetites & savor your meals surrounded by the tall trees. A soak in the bubbly hot tub next to the outdoor gas fireplace is just the thing to melt away your worries before drifting off to a restful sleep. And speaking of sleep, you’ll have space for up to 10 guests in the three large bedrooms. In the morning, it's a short drive to Gatlinburg or Pigeon Forge on easy access roads for all the attractions your family wants to see. About the area

Sevierville

Located in Sevierville, this cabin is near theme parks and in the mountains. Dolly Parton's Stampede Dinner Attraction and Titanic Museum are cultural highlights, and some of the area's popular attractions include Wild Bear Falls Indoor Water Park and Anakeesta. Ripley's Aquarium of the Smokies and Dollywood's Splash Country are not to be missed. Power boating offers a great chance to get out on the surrounding water, or you can seek out an adventure with horse riding, ecotours and hiking/biking trails nearby.

Close to entertainment, still feels a little secluded

This is a Beautiful cabin. It was closer to Pigeon Forge than we realized so definitely did not feel as "away" as we expected. But it is tucked away behind a hill and surrounded by trees so doesn't feel too close to any other cabins. Our only issue was that the gas fireplace didn't always start and would leave a gas smell. But if you turned out off and on again it was usually fine. The game room was really fun and having a movie night at the house after a long day of activity was perfect. Overall this was a great place to stay.
